The Appropriations Committee added $278 million in this conference report for veterans medical care, a significant increase over the President's budget request. It was my understanding that a portion of this increase will go to New England.
Said by
Patrick Leahy
Democratic · Vermont

Editor's note · Context

Discussing funding for veterans medical care during a conference report.
